
Interagency Council on Homelessness (USICH)
The Interagency Council on Homelessness (USICH) is a federal organization that coordinates efforts across different government agencies to address and reduce homelessness in the United States. Its role is to develop national strategies, promote effective programs, and foster collaboration among federal, state, and local entities. USICH works to improve housing options, services, and policies for those experiencing homelessness, with the goal of ending homelessness nationwide. It does not provide direct services but facilitates a unified approach to create sustainable solutions for vulnerable populations.
